The Sustainable Attributes of PVC Film
Recyclability: PVC film is highly recyclable, which means it can be collected and processed at the end of its life to be reused in new products. This attribute significantly reduces waste and contributes to a circular economy, minimizing the environmental impact of plastic waste.

Energy EfficiencyPVC production is more energy-efficient compared to other thermoplastics. The lower energy consumption during manufacturing results in reduced greenhouse gas emissions, aligning with the global push for more sustainable industrial practices.
Longevity: The durability of PVC film means it lasts longer, reducing the need for frequent replacements. This extended lifespan decreases the overall environmental footprint by lowering the demand for new materials and reducing waste generation.
Low Carbon Footprint: PVC has a lower carbon footprint compared to many other materials due to its efficient production process and long-lasting nature. This makes it a more environmentally friendly choice for applications where longevity is desired.

Non-toxicity and Safety: PVC is non-toxic and has been thoroughly tested for environmental effects. It meets a variety of health and safety standards, including those set by the FDA, CPSC, NSF, and ISS. This ensures that PVC film is safe for use in applications that come into contact with food, water, and other sensitive environments.
Fire Resistance: PVC's fire-resistant properties mean it does not ignite easily and is self-extinguishing. This reduces the risk of fire-related damage and the release of harmful substances into the environment.
Versatility in Green Applications: PVC's versatility extends to its use in green applications, such as in the production of sustainable construction materials, agricultural films, and eco-friendly packaging solutions.
